Output 84a1eb5ef4b3d3249422470477eb158733c8f75d63e1cfc74626fbbd32175a62:0

value
5000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ad6ac39f20202185221c9f396cee80581759dee OP_EQUAL
address
38Wj6TsA8qf7LVVA8D7HMGobBVEmVS1Jek
transaction
84a1eb5ef4b3d3249422470477eb158733c8f75d63e1cfc74626fbbd32175a62
confirmations
326487
spent
true